Hi, I'd like to show you my little video game I have been working on for the last couple of months – Cavimilation.
It began its life as my school project hence it did spend almost no time on the drawing board, but I still think there is fun to be had!
Cavimilation is a platformer/shooter "high score chasing" game with procedurally generated levels and minimalistic visuals.
You try to gain the highest score possible by exploring an endlessly generated cave, collecting treasure, and defeating enemies. You can compare scores with your friends on steam leaderboards.
